Prime Cut Concrete Sawing & Drilling, C-61/D-6 Concrete-Related Services Contractor in Alamo, CA
Prime Cut Concrete Sawing & Drilling operating as a sole owner holds California contractor license #809448, which is currently expired (lapsed Jun 30, 2026) and not valid to contract until it is renewed. First issued in 2002, the license has been on the CSLB roster for 24 years. It carries a single CSLB classification: C-61/D-6 — Concrete-Related Services Contractor. Records show an active surety bond on file with North River Insurance Company (the) and active workers' compensation coverage from Insurance Company of the West. The business is based in Alamo, in Contra Costa County, California.
